How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 0.019 units per person against 0.0187 units per person in Cuba, a difference of 0.0003 units per person.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was New Zealand ahead.
Cuba ranks 57th and New Zealand ranks 54th of 218 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Cuba averaged higher in 2 and New Zealand in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cuba |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.0039 units per person | 0.0097 units per person | 0.0058 units per person | New Zealand |
| 1970s | 0.0046 units per person | 0.0096 units per person | 0.005 units per person | New Zealand |
| 1980s | 0.008 units per person | 0.0119 units per person | 0.0039 units per person | New Zealand |
| 1990s | 0.0092 units per person | 0.0134 units per person | 0.0042 units per person | New Zealand |
| 2000s | 0.0109 units per person | 0.0135 units per person | 0.0026 units per person | New Zealand |
| 2010s | 0.014 units per person | 0.0138 units per person | 0.0002 units per person | Cuba |
| 2020s | 0.0178 units per person | 0.017 units per person | 0.0008 units per person | Cuba |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population ages 75-79, female div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
